About

Torry Akins is a pioneering roboticist whose work focuses on deploying autonomous systems in extreme, inhospitable environments. His primary research areas include field robotics, autonomous navigation, and the development of ruggedized platforms for scientific data collection. Akins’s most significant contribution is the design and deployment of MARVIN II, a mobile robot built to autonomously traverse polar ice sheets and collect critical radar measurements. This work directly addresses the challenge of automating research in harsh conditions, reducing the need for dangerous human involvement in the field. His landmark paper, "Mobile Robots for Harsh Environments: Lessons Learned from Field Experiments," has garnered 10 citations and serves as a foundational reference for engineers building robots for Arctic and Antarctic exploration.
